Awards Received

  • Distinguished Flying Cross

    Service:

    United States Marine Corps

    Rank:

    First Lieutenant

    Action Date:

    February 21 to March 1, 1945

    Commanding General, Fleet Marine Force Pacific: Serial 7284 (August 4, 1947)

    The President of the United States of America takes pleasure in presenting the Distinguished Flying Cross to First Lieutenant James D. Batson (MCSN: 0-29423), United States Marine Corps, for extraordinary achievement while participating in aerial flight in the China Sea – Ryukyu Islands Area from 21 February to 1 March 1945. First Lieutenant Batson completed twenty flights in a combat area where enemy anti-aircraft fire was expected to be effective or where enemy aircraft patrols usually occurred. His conduct throughout has distinguished him among those performing duties of the same character.
